One Million Wii’s In August?

July 7th, 2006
20060608p2a00m0na001000p_size6.jpgChinese newspaper Commercial Times reports that chipmakers SiS and ATi are getting a lot of orders on the Wii and Xbox360 hardware lately. ATi’s consumer electronics chips business rose from 15% to 20% this year due to the demand from Nintendo.

More interestingly though, PixArt Imaging, the supplier of the sensors in the Wiimote said to the newspaper that the shipments of its hardware will reach one million in August.

This doesn’t necessarily mean there would be one million Wii consoles ready in August, but it’s a good indication of an earlier launch than the rumored early November date. The Wii has been in production since late June, and it looks like Nintendo will meet the goal of 2 million consoles by late December.

Via DigiTimes
